In the Forest City area, the average cost ranges from $0.25 to $0.50 per square foot, with most whole-home services falling between $150-$400. Key factors include the carpet's soil level, the cleaning method required (e.g., hot water extraction for deep-seated Illinois prairie dust), and any necessary pre-treatment for high-traffic areas or local allergens like pollen common in our rural region. Always request an in-home estimate for the most accurate pricing.
Late spring (May) and early fall (September) are ideal in Forest City. These periods typically offer lower humidity, which allows carpets to dry faster and more thoroughly, preventing mold or mildew. Avoiding the peak summer humidity and the wet, salty conditions of winter also helps protect your carpet's backing and fibers from excess moisture and tracked-in road treatments.

Look for a provider with strong local references, verifiable insurance, and certification from the Institute of Inspection, Cleaning and Restoration Certification (IICRC). A trustworthy local company will offer a clear explanation of their process, provide a detailed written estimate, and understand the specific challenges of homes in our area, such as dealing with clay-based soils and agricultural particulates.
Yes, professional cleaners in Forest City are experienced with these local challenges. Mud and field residue require specific enzymatic or alkaline pre-treatments. Rust stains, often from our area's mineral-heavy well water, need specialized acidic treatments that are safe for carpets. Always point out these stains beforehand so the technician can bring the appropriate, targeted solutions for the best results.
